Develop and ensure delivery of comprehensive integrated plans, including timelines and budgets, and ensure alignment with company goals.
Identify opportunities for process improvements and implement best practices in project management. Proactively share lessons learned within the team and across the organization.
Bachelor's degree required. Master's preferred. Minimum of 15+ years' experience relevant broad project / program management experience required, preferably in the pharmaceutical or related industry
Have extensive experience in Pharma R&D project management, a deep understanding of the end-to-end drug development process and a proven ability to deliver results
Have excellent written, verbal, and interpersonal communication skills and the ability to effectively interact with all levels both internal and external to the company in order to establish credibility with professionals on the project teams.
Have strong presentation and critical thinking skills.
Actively promote constructive interactions among team members to address difficult situations.
Resolve and negotiate conflicts or problems with tact, diplomacy and composure.
Handle multiple projects and priorities with exceptional organizational and time management skills
